Why this album works

Flyleaf debuted at number 57 on the Billboard 200 and became one of the defining albums of the Christian rock movement. It garnered significant critical acclaim, particularly for its single 'I'm So Sick,' which received substantial airplay and helped cement the band's popularity.

Context
Released in 2005, Flyleaf's self-titled debut marked the band's entrance into the music scene following their formation in 2002. This album laid the groundwork for their subsequent success, showcasing singer Lacey Sturm's powerful vocals and establishing them as a prominent act in the post-grunge genre.
